MQによって引き起こされるべき等性の問題の原因と解決策

理由:

コンシューマーが指定された時間内に結果を報告しないか、例外をスローし、MQへの技術的なフィードバックがない場合、MQはデフォルトでサーバーコンシューマーがエラーを消費し、消費メッセージの送信を再試行します。再試行プロセス中、MQは繰り返し消費の問題。

解決策:

プロデューサはメッセージヘッダーに注文番号などのグローバルビジネス固有IDを設定し、コンシューマはデータがグローバルIDに従って消費されたかどうかを判断します。

120件の元の記事を公開 賞賛36件 70,000回

おすすめ

転載: blog.csdn.net/q15102780705/article/details/105577892